Choosing the best portable music player involves understanding several key factors beyond just storage capacity or price. The right device depends on how you listen—whether you prioritize sound quality, streaming, or portability. Considering these factors carefully can help avoid common pitfalls, like buying a device with limited format support or poor battery life. Here are some essential considerations to keep in mind:Sound Quality and Audio Formats
High-resolution audio support and quality DACs make a significant difference in sound clarity. If you’re an audiophile, look for devices supporting formats like DSD, FLAC, or LDAC. Cheaper players may compress audio or lack advanced DACs, resulting in a less immersive experience. Be aware that some devices prioritize wireless convenience over wired audio fidelity, so choose accordingly.
Storage and Expandability
While many models come with fixed storage, expandable options like microSD slots provide flexibility. Consider how much space you need—if you listen to large high-res files or many playlists, opt for a device with at least 128GB of internal storage or support for expansion. Beware of devices with limited storage that might require frequent file management or transfers.
Connectivity and Streaming
Bluetooth 5.0 or higher and WiFi are now standard, enabling seamless wireless streaming from services like Spotify or Tidal. Devices with WiFi often support Tidal, Qobuz, or Amazon Music, making them suitable for streaming enthusiasts. However, some models still focus solely on local playback, which may suit those who prefer offline listening or want to avoid data usage.
Ease of Use and Interface
Touchscreens provide intuitive navigation but can increase device size. Physical controls might appeal to those who prefer tactile feedback. Consider the interface’s responsiveness, menu complexity, and whether the device supports apps or offers firmware updates. Simplicity can be advantageous for less tech-savvy users, while more advanced interfaces suit audiophiles seeking customization.
Battery Life and Build Quality
Long battery life ensures extended listening without frequent recharges, especially important for travel. Durability and build material also matter if you plan to carry your player outdoors. Lightweight devices sacrifice some robustness, whereas sturdier models might be bulkier but more resilient. Balance these aspects based on your typical usage environment.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use a portable music player for streaming music?
Yes, many modern portable music players support WiFi and Bluetooth, making streaming from services like Spotify, Tidal, or Amazon Music straightforward. Devices with WiFi often run Android or custom OS with app support, offering a seamless streaming experience. However, some budget models focus solely on local playback, so it’s essential to verify streaming compatibility if that’s a priority for you.
Is high-resolution audio worth it on a portable music player?
High-resolution audio can offer noticeably better sound clarity, especially with high-quality headphones and DACs. If you’re an audiophile or use high-end gear, a device supporting formats like DSD, FLAC, or LDAC will provide a richer listening experience. For casual listeners with standard earbuds, the difference may be less perceptible, so weigh the added cost against your listening preferences.
Should I choose a device with a touchscreen or physical controls?
Touchscreens make navigation intuitive and allow access to more features, but they can make the device bulkier and more fragile. Physical controls offer tactile feedback, which many users prefer for quick, one-handed operation. Your choice depends on how you plan to use the player—if portability and durability are key, physical buttons might be better; for versatility, a touchscreen is often more convenient.
How much storage do I really need in a portable music player?
The amount of storage depends on your listening habits. If you primarily stream or listen to compressed files, 32-64GB might suffice. For high-res files or large collections, 128GB or more is recommended, especially if you don’t want to manage files frequently. Always consider the possibility of expansion via microSD cards to future-proof your device without overspending on internal storage.
Is it better to buy a dedicated music player or use a smartphone?
Dedicated music players often deliver superior audio quality, longer battery life, and features tailored for audiophiles, avoiding the distractions of a smartphone. They also tend to be more durable and have better support for high-res formats. However, smartphones combine multiple functions in one device, making them more convenient for casual use. Your choice hinges on whether you prioritize pure audio performance or device versatility.
